you don't specify what. but with projectors using metal halide lamps, the lamps are under extremely high pressure, if you heard a pop then chances are your lamp exploded.
Typically the lamp ballast will try to strike the lamp three times, you should hear a buzzing sound, then basically fan noise then a buzzing, fan noise, finally a buzzing, then typically the fans will go to cool down mode and two minutes later your projector will be off.
If when you power it on, you do not hear a buzzing and if the lamp inside is still good, then your ballast is probably shot, but I would put my first guess on exploded lamp
